原创 《調優JVM內存解決OutOfMemoryError 》

《調優JVM內存解決OutOfMemoryError 》 從VM規範中我們可以得到,一下幾種異常。      java.lang.StackOverflowError:(很少)      java.lang.OutOfMemoryEr

原创 java虛擬機調優常識

jvm的調整沒什麼技巧,只有一些原則,要根據自己應用的特點來設定調優的目標,這裏收集了一些內容,權當記錄   Java heap (Xmx, Xms) 和java進程的heap是兩回事情 java進程的heap包含:    Java He

原创 Commons Daemon 之 procrun

Procrun是一套讓Java應用程序運行在WIN#@下更容易的庫和應用程序。Procrun服務應用程序 Prunsrv一個讓應用程序作爲服務運行的

原创 Nginx的upstream 支持算法

Nginx的upstream目前支持5種方式的分配 1 輪詢(默認) 每個請求按時間順序逐一分配到不同的後端服務器,如果後端服務器down掉,能自動

原创 JVM內存管理:深入Java內存區域與OOM

Java與C++之間有一堵由內存動態分配和垃圾收集技術所圍成的高牆,牆外面的人想進去,牆裏面的人卻想出來。   概述: 對於從事C、C++程序開發的開發人員來說,在內存管理領域,他們即是擁有最高權力的皇帝又是執行最基礎工作的勞動人民——擁

原创 JDK5.0垃圾收集優化之--Don't Pause

   作者:江南白衣,最新版鏈接:http://blog.csdn.net/calvinxiu/archive/2007/05/18/1614473

原创 JVM 調優 技巧

JVM 調優 技巧 博客分類: jdk1.升級 JVM 版本。如果能使用64-bit,使用64-bit JVM。                        基本上沒什麼好解釋的,很簡單將JVM升級到最新的版本。如果你還是使用JDK

原创 淘寶開放平臺回顧與前景展望

淘寶開放平臺回顧與前景展望 blueski推薦 [2011-2-22]出處:infoQ作者:放翁  由於時間比較倉促,寫的有些凌亂,有興趣的同學可以更多的線下溝通。 回顧 淘寶的開放算上2010年已經走了快三個年頭了,從服務提供者的角色

原创 理解 Linux 的處理器負載均值(翻譯)

  理解 Linux 的處理器負載均值(翻譯)August 4, 2009 原文鏈接: http://blog.scoutapp.com/ar

原创 Jetty 架構

Jetty6的架構 Connector(連接器)集合負責接收HTTP連接。handler(處理器)集合負責處理連接請求並給予響應。而Jetty Server(服務器)則是前兩者的管道連接器。負責創建並初始化connector、handl

原创 見面三分情

[見面三分情]是人人都能上口的一句話,我不知道外國是不是有類似的話,不過外國有沒有這句話不重要,因爲我們絕大部份時間都和中國人相處,所以你一定要對這

原创 一次Java垃圾收集調優實戰

1 資料 JDK5.0垃圾收集優化之--Don't Pause(花錢的年華) 編寫對GC友好,又不泄漏的代碼(花錢的年華) JVM調優總結 JDK 6所有選項及默認值 2 GC日誌打印   GC調優是個很實驗很伽利略的活兒,GC日誌是先決

原创 GC相關調整的目標

GC相關調整的目標: * 短生命週期的對象不要進入Old區 * 短生命週期的對象在minor GC的時候幹掉 * 長生命週期的對象要放到Old區 * 長生命週期的對象可以被Full GC清理掉,但是Full GC要調整到儘量少發生

原创 關於Java性能監控的一些記錄

本篇所有內容都是基於JDK5,如使用JDK6會有差別。     在前些日子,我們做了一些性能監控的工作,有一些值得記錄的地方:     JDK自身提

原创 經驗交流:淺談研發團隊的組建

  團隊的組建    一個完全由精英組成的團隊不一定是好的團隊。對於一個研發性組織來說,需要各種不同能力的人以及不同專長的人加入.比如:精通編程的,熟悉數據庫的,長於溝通交際的,長於思考的,長於行動的,長於決策的,願意服從的。